Product Development

RC-135 operational systems development and enhancement activities support design studies, engineering analysis, non-recurring engineering and other efforts associated with the integration and modification of the RC-135 programs and their specialized mission systems, both air and ground. Associated ground systems include RIVET JOINT Ground Data Processing Systems (GDPS), Distributed Mission Shelters (DMS), Mission Crew Training Systems (MCTS), Airborne Capabilities Extension System (ACES), and the Operational Flight Trainers (OFT, a.k.a. flight deck simulators). RC-135 funding also supports innovation activities to include studies, analyses, requirements definition, and quick-reaction capability prototypes/demonstrations to accelerate planning for technology transition, technology insertion and future acquisition programs. Extensive utilization of Commercial-Off-The-Shelf (COTS) based solutions allows rapid fielding of needed capabilities through upgrades and supports Diminishing Manufacturing Sources (DMS)/Vanishing Vendor Items (VVI) logistics mitigation efforts. The results of these efforts provide for preliminary assessments of technical feasibility, operability, or military utility as well as specific engineering implementations for integration into the various systems baseline configurations. These activities are managed by the 645th Aeronautical Systems Group (645 AESG). The 645 AESG (a.k.a. BIG SAFARI) manages engineering, ground and support systems modifications, integration, flight testing, product assurance, acceptance testing, logistics, and training activities. Aircraft, sensor systems, and associated ground support system engineering planned for FY 2027 budget includes developmental planning, execution and support for the RC-135V/W RIVET JOINT Baselines 13, 14, and 15 (BL-13, BL-14, and BL-15), the RC-135U COMBAT SENT Baselines 6 and 15 (BL-6 and BL-15), and the RC-135S COBRA BALL BL-7, BL-14, and BL-15 configurations. COMBAT SENT has renumbered their baselines going forward to align with RIVET JOINT baseline numbering to take advantage of the baseline commonalities for technical manuals, training systems, contracting, and security certifications.

The RC-135 RIVET JOINT, COBRA BALL, and COMBAT SENT configured aircraft are maintained and kept technologically relevant through an incremental baseline upgrade acquisition strategy. Technology upgrades and Quick Reaction Capability (QRC) developments are acquired through the 645 AESG in accordance with the BIG SAFARI Program Management Directive (PMD) and Class Justification and Approval (J&A) document for acquisition of supplies and services using an "other than full and open competition" criteria.
